The Land of Tigers
The city is home to Kanha National Park, one of the largest parks in Madhya Pradesh and a popular place to spot the magnificent Royal Bengal Tiger in its natural habitat. Apart from tigers, you can also see leopards and barasingha deer here.

Maharashtra's Oldest & Largest Wildlife Hotspot
Located about three hours from the nearest airport at Nagpur, Tadoba is known for its flourishing wildlife, particularly, its large population of Royal Bengal Tigers.

Renowned Wildlife Reserve in Rajasthan
Spanning over 800 square kilometres in the Alwar district of Rajasthan, this National Park nestled amidst the mighty Aravalli Hills is home to a diverse variety of wildlife species, grasslands and deciduous forests.

Nature Lovers’ Paradise
Masinagudi is a small town situated in the Nilgiri district of Tamil Nadu, India. It is surrounded by dense forests, tea and coffee plantations, and wildlife sanctuaries. Masinagudi is known for its scenic beauty and wildlife, and it attracts a large number of tourists every year. The town also has many trekking trails and waterfalls, making it a great destination for adventure lovers.
